About Leisure Energy Ltd
About us
Leisure Energy is an award-winning renewable technology company, energy consultancy, and principal contractor. We specialise in identifying, designing, and delivering comprehensive energy and sustainability solutions, supporting both public and private leisure sectors on their journey to full decarbonisation and electrification.

We are leading the sector’s transition to net zero for leisure facilities, providing fully managed, end-to-end integrated solutions. Our approach combines innovative design with pioneering technology to maximise efficiency, performance, and long-term sustainability.

Our team brings together highly qualified professionals from the leisure, energy, and engineering sectors. This multidisciplinary expertise gives us a unique understanding of the complex demands of leisure and pool environments, enabling us to deliver tailored, high-impact solutions for our clients.

Background
Founded in 2014 by Graham Clarkson, who had a vision to enable leisure and sports facilities to become more sustainable, through lowering the carbon footprint and reduce costs - we were doing this when it was less cool!

The company is wholly owned by the chairman and directors.


Main products and services
We provide a comprehensive, end-to-end service that supports clients throughout the full decarbonisation/electrification journey of their buildings—from energy surveys, feasibility studies, and strategic decarbonisation planning through to detailed design, construction, and ongoing aftercare and maintenance.

Our products include the installation of solar PV systems, Building Energy Management systems, pool pumps, air conditioning systems and our innovative, high-efficiency heat pump solution; the Net Zero Pod (NZP). The NZP is an external prefabricated packaged plant room designed to replace or integrate with existing heating systems making the transition to low-carbon buildings more practical and cost-effective.

Our product differs from conventional energy installations primarily due to its modular prefabricated, "packaged plant room" design combined with the use of a highly efficient R744 (CO₂) natural refrigerant. The result delivering a low Global Warming Potential of 1 (GWP) and Seasonal Co-efficient of Performance (sCOP) of 4+ (meaning that for every 1 unit of energy input at least 4 units of heat are generated). The ASHP system has been specifically engineered for leisure facilities and swimming pools.

Being a packaged plant room with all the technology inside the NZP, our solution minimises the need for extensive modifications within interior plant rooms and existing infrastructure of the leisure facility.

Our true differentiator for the sector is that we truly understand the operational requirements and customer expectations in public leisure centres and private clubs. Almost always, there is no building shut-down, minimal impact on the customer experience, delivered in a live operating environment ensuring no loss of income.
